加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 综合聚焦 > 服务器 > Windows > 正文

windows – 如何通过gpo轻松部署MS修补程序KB959628 exe / msp?

发布时间:2020-12-14 00:02:22 所属栏目:Windows 来源:网络整理
导读:我得到了一个Microsoft修补程序,我需要在整个域上进行部署.我想使用GPO,因为用户没有管理员权限,Office未从管理点部署.它是在个人基础上随机部署的. 我尝试将exe转换为msi但是当我运行msi时它只是提取了MSP文件. 我可以通过GPO在各种版本的Office 2003中部署
我得到了一个Microsoft修补程序,我需要在整个域上进行部署.我想使用GPO,因为用户没有管理员权限,Office未从管理点部署.它是在个人基础上随机部署的.
我尝试将exe转换为msi但是当我运行msi时它只是提取了MSP文件.

我可以通过GPO在各种版本的Office 2003中部署MSP或EXE吗?

我拿了一份Pro11.msi并尝试运行MSIexec.exe / a“[outlook.msi path]”/ P“[Outlook.exe path]”
与MSP文件相同.两次我都收到错误消息“无法打开安装包.请联系应用程序供应商以验证这是否是有效的Windows Installer程序包”.

另一种解决方案是否可以通过WSUS进行部署?

是的,实际上.如果您没有使用WSUS / SCCM / etc解决方案来推出补丁,最简单的解决方案是带有启动脚本的GPO.

例如,我在下面为不同的修补程序做了什么. (这是我的批处理文件)

echo off

reg query “H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ows NTCurrentVersionHotFixKB968730”
if %errorlevel%==1 (goto Install) else (goto End)

REM If errorlevel returns a value of 1,it means the key is not present,thus the hotfix is not installed. So install it.

:Install

[Sysvol on my domain]scriptsScriptfilesWindowsXP-KB968730-x86-ENU.exe /quiet

REM If errorlevel returns a value other than 1,the key is present,and the hotfix is already installed,or something odd’s going on. No installation.

:End

然后我将该批处理文件脚本放在SYSVOL中,所有域计算机和用户都可以在该处创建,并创建一个GPO以在启动时运行该脚本. [启动脚本在SYSTEM上下文中启动,因此用户权限无关紧要.]正确链接GPO,等待,并在下次用户重新启动时完成作业.

启动脚本在Computer – >下配置.政策 – > Windows设置 – >脚本 – >当然,通过组策略管理编辑器启动.

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读